Meet Priya Batheja
With over 18 years of dedicated experience in special education, Priya Batheja is a resource specialist committed to empowering students with mild to moderate disabilities. She holds a Bachelor’s degree in Liberal Studies from CSU Hayward and specializes in developing Individualized Education Programs (IEPs), as well as providing targeted reading and math interventions. Priya’s approach is centered on fostering academic skills, confidence, and independence in K-8 students. Her extensive experience includes one-on-one and small group instruction, ensuring that each student receives personalized attention tailored to their unique needs. Priya collaborates closely with parents, staff, and SELPA to create a supportive learning environment that promotes student success.

Comprehensive Academic Assessments for Student Success
Priya Batheja utilizes comprehensive academic assessments, including the WIAT-III and WJ-III, to pinpoint students’ strengths and areas needing improvement. These assessments provide valuable insights that guide personalized instruction and support effective IEP development, ensuring each student reaches their full potential.
- WIAT-III: Assesses reading, math, and written language skills.
- WJ-III: Evaluates cognitive abilities and academic achievement.
